Planning a Motorcycle Holiday

Just because you love your motorcycle (motorbike) does not mean you can not enjoy the magnificent places we have in Australia (or the world for that matter).

A motorcycle holiday can be a very low cost method of touring. By carefully choosing the right machine, equipment and clothing, it is possible for one or two people to enjoy a camping holiday by motorbike. Many bikes fuel consumption are in the range of 16-20 km/L and can hold sufficient spare parts, equipment and personal gear for quite long trips.

It is best to avoid extremes of temperature when travelling. You will get tired quickly in hot weather, and cold weather presents a health hazard with the wet conditions and if the rider is not warmly clothed. Avoid the far north of Australia in the wet season. I have found it best to travel in any month of the year without an “R” in it – Think about it (May, June, July, and August). April and September are also okay.

Do not ride on country roads if riding a motorcycle designed for city use. A multi-purpose motorbike is better for off-road or poor road conditions. Before setting out give careful thought to the choice of motorcycle, what are you going to pack your things in, what camping equipment and clothing are you going to take, how long are you going for?

We have listed here our various topics dealing with you enjoying your motorcycle on a camping holiday. However, the first thing you need to decide is where you are going, when you are going and how long you are going for. This will dictate quite significantly what you will need to purchase for your motorcycle holiday.
